Rory Laird (DEF, $442,000) backed up his 109 from two games ago with a season high 110 this week. He has been in sensational form scoring 99+ in four of his last five games this year. Speaking of form, Patrick Dangerfield (MID, $592,000) kept his great run going with 108 while Josh Jenkins (FWD, $351,000) kicked a handful of goals for his 106.

Brodie Smith (DEF, $353,000) finally returned for 72 and after this bye he is now ready to be traded into your team after his poor run of luck has seen him drop $112,000 in price.

Mitch Grigg (FWD/MID, $384,000) scored 84 but could have been much more. He missed three goals from his 19 touches and Eddie Betts (FWD, $438,000) had a day to forget against his old team scoring just 39. He walked away with the important four points though and I’m guessing Eddie would be happier with that, but he will have difficulty explaining it to his loyal Fantasy coaches though.

ON THE RADAR
Rory Sloane
(MID, $523,000) returned on the weekend after spending four weeks on the sidelines and now is the time to bring him back in. Sloane started the year with scores of 112, 117 and 130 and posted 82 on the weekend. He’s cheap and prime for the picking.

On the other hand,and I hate to say it, but Cam Ellis-Yolmen’s (MID, $493,000) time is almost up. He scored 46 on the weekend and sat out the last part of the game in a dirty red vest. He’s made us some great money since the start of the year and now must be upgraded over the bye rounds.

WHAT’S COMING UP
This week, the Crows will have a well-earned rest with the Round 11 bye. Watch for Brad Crouch (MID, $524,000) to return too in Round 12 after his first game in the SANFL on the weekend saw him find the ball 33 times.

So put your feet up Crows fans, enjoy the week off and get ready for the second half of the season.
